Tour Itinerary:

Day 1: Ollantaytambo / Salineras / Maras / Tiobamba. At 8am Pick you up from your hotel in Cusco. Transfer to ranch, located in the sacred valley (Ollantaytambo). At ranch we will meet our Peruvian Paso horses and complete explanation about the premises and an introduction of our national horse, riding courses and equitation lead by an experience instructor. After lunch we depart toward the picturesque village of Ollantaytambo. We will cross the Urubamba River. Then to the salt platforms of Salineras (Inca times), still being used by the locals to extract salt from the mountain spring water. Where the salty water is channeled through an impressive irrigation system and left to evaporate in the sun.

Continue 2 hours climbing riding the horses (1000m) to reach the high Andean. Over at 3750m the stunning scenery and the snow-capped mountains of Chicon, Veronica and SalKantay is impressive. Following a typical Andean trail to Maras village and then connect to Tiobamba, where we will leave our horses to rest. Stay in tents in the middle of the country.

Day 2: Tiobamba / Chekoq / Moray / Cusco. After breakfast departure from the church of Tiobamba, will continuing to visit the ruins of Chekoq (cold storage depots). Cooling of the products was achieved by using a genius system of underground air-circulation. Ride to Lake Huaypo, there will have lunch with spectacular scenery of snow-capped mountains, wildflowers and beautiful mountain lakes. Ride to Moray terraces, this area was served as an experimental agricultural station for the development of different crop strains, using the climates of different ecological zones. There are no great ruins in Moray to impress visitors. Moray is more for the contemplative traveler with an affinity for such phenomena as the Nasca Lines. From Moray we come back down to the Valley floor, after 6 hours arrive to the ranch. At 4pm transfer back to Cusco.
